The 485SD9TB is a port-powered two-channel RS-232 to RS-485 converter. It converts the TD and RD RS-232 lines to balanced half-duplex RS-485 signals. The unit is powered from the RS-232 data and handshake lines whether the lines are high or low. An external power supply can be connected to two terminals on the RS-485 connector if no handshake lines are available. The 485SD9TB has a DB-9 female connector on the RS-232 side and a terminal block connector on the RS-485 side.
